Sunday School Winter Clothing Drive = HUGE Success!
The Senior High Sunday School Class at the Pocahontas Center spearheaded a Winter Clothing Drive at our church. They challenged each class to see who could bring the most items to help make a difference. They even involved the congregation by putting a box on each side of the aisle, and challenged us to see which side would bring more items.
All in all, Share the Warmth was a huge success! The Sr. High class reported how many hats, gloves, coats, sweatpants, etc were all donated and taken to the Upper Des Moines Office in Pocahontas. They were also very diplomatic by declaring that it was a tie between both sides of the congregation!
Through the help of our generous congregation, along with the Sunday School classes, we were able to collect:
- 4 pairs of boots
- 116 pairs of socks
- 121 pairs of gloves
- 170 hats
- 4 scarves
- 11 coats
- 2 pairs of snowpants
- 2 sweaters
If you do the math, that’s 430 items we were able to donate to Upper Des Moines!!! They were so very grateful to receive these winter necessities!!
